Kodagu District Sees Record 95 Lakh Tourists in Last 2 Years, Plans for Water Sports and Adventure Tourism Development.

Thursday, Jul 31, 2025 11:56 am ET1min read

Kodagu district in Karnataka has recorded over 95 lakh tourists in the last two years, with 43.69 lakh in 2023 and 45.72 lakh in 2024. The district has 23 tourist destinations identified under the Karnataka Tourism Policy 2020-26, including Raja Seat, Madikeri Fort, and Nagarhole National Park. Plans are in place to develop Mandalpatti and start a children's mini train at Raja Seat.
